Bill Summary
For legislation relative to agricultural commission input on board of health regulations. Public Health.
AI Summary
This bill amends the existing law to require the board of health in a municipality with a municipal agricultural commission to provide the commission with a copy of any proposed regulations that impact farmers markets, farms, the non-commercial keeping of poultry, livestock, and bees, and the non-commercial production of fruit, vegetables, and horticultural plants. The agricultural commission would then have a 45-day review period to hold a public meeting and provide written comments and recommendations to the board of health. The bill also allows the board of health to issue emergency orders without a public hearing if they determine an emergency exists, but they must follow the local enforcement emergency procedures outlined in the law.
